La Chacarita Cemetery

Buenos Aires, Argentina · built 1887

La Chacarita Cemetery (Cementerio de la Chacarita, also known as "Cementerio del Oeste") is a cemetery in the Chacarita neighborhood in Buenos Aires, Argentina. It is the largest in the country, with an area of 95 hectares (230 acres). Chacarita Cemetery has designated areas for members of the Argentine artistic community, including writers, prominent composers and actors. The Justicialist leader and former president Juan Perón was buried here until his remains were relocated in 2006 to a mausoleum in his former home in San Vicente.
